Public bug reported: When I run Etherape as a normal user it launches, but as my system is configured so that only root can capture, I am forced to run Etherape with sudo, however this means that the only output I get is this and that the program does not work as it does not launch and just exist after printing this:
No protocol specified (etherape:2294): Gtk-WARNING **: cannot open display: :0 I am running Ubuntu GNOME 16.10 with GNOME 3.22 and this only started happening after I switched from Xorg to Wayland via the login screen.
